East Cleveland, OH Local Guide

Cheapest Available East Cleveland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in East Cleveland, OH is a Studio unit found at Indian Hills Senior Community in the South Collinwood neighborhood priced from $670. Kemper House in the Shaker Lakes ne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$700. Here is today’s list of the most affordable East Cleveland apartments for rent:

Best Value Apartments for Rent in East Cleveland, OH

As of September 18, 2025 the best value apartment in the East Cleveland area is the $0.47 price per square foot Center Unit Model at Hessler 113 Townhomes in the in the University Area neighborhood starting from $995. The second greatest value East Cleveland apartment is the Private Bedroom in a 4 Bedroom 4.5 Bath (per be... Model at Reserve Overlook starting at $940 with a $0.57 price per square foot in the University Area neighborhood. Here is today’s list of the best values for East Cleveland apartments based on price per square foot:

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ap East Cleveland Apartments

What is the Cheapest Studio apartment in East Cleveland?

Currently the most affordable Cheap Studio Apartment in East Cleveland is at Indian Hills Senior Community listed at $670.

How much is rent for a Cheap One Bedroom East Cleveland Apartment?

The lowest price for a Cheap One Bedroom East Cleveland Apartment is $700 at Shakertowne Apartments.

What is the lowest price for a Cheap Two Bedroom East Cleveland Apartment for rent?

Today's best deal for a Cheap Two Bedroom Apartment in East Cleveland is starting from $800 at 11502 Saywell Ave.

What is the most affordable East Cleveland Three Bedroom Apartment?

The best deal on a cheap East Cleveland Three Bedroom Apartment rental is at Masonic Towers Apartments and starts from $1,005.
